A Guide to Online Gambling Licensing and Regulation

How can gamblers ensure their online gambling experience is secure and reliable? A fundamental aspect lies in comprehending online gaming licensing and regulatory frameworks. Licensing guarantees that gambling operators comply with rigorous standards set by regulatory bodies. These permits are generally awarded by well-established governing bodies, which monitor the fairness and security of gambling operations.

Licensed sites use cutting-edge security measures, including encryption technology, to safeguard sensitive personal and financial data. Moreover, these providers are obligated to conduct periodic audits, ensuring conformity with legal and ethical guidelines. Users should identify sites showing their regulatory information visibly, as this indicates a dedication to transparency.

Moreover, recognizing the regulatory framework in your jurisdiction can shed light on the rights granted to players. By opting for licensed platforms, players can substantially reduce the risk of fraud and enhance their overall gaming experience, cultivating a secure online environment for all participants involved.

Recognizing Types of Online Gambling Scams

Even within a landscape of trusted online gambling platforms, players must remain vigilant against various scams that could threaten their personal safety and funds. A prevalent type is the phishing scam, where criminals mimic authentic sites to capture sensitive details. Players might receive emails or communications that seem legitimate, leading them to reveal personal and sensitive details.

Another common scam features fake websites that lure players with attractive bonuses and promotions but eventually withhold payments. These sites often lack proper licensing and regulation. Furthermore, manipulated games pose a serious risk, where algorithms manipulate outcomes to favor the house unfairly.

Moreover, players must be cautious of deceptive strategies, where scammers take advantage of trust and emotions to obtain account credentials. By spotting these deceptive practices, users can secure their information and make smart decisions, guaranteeing a more secure online gaming environment.

Detecting Warning Signs

How can individuals tell when their gambling habits could be developing into a problem? Spotting warning signs plays a vital role in sustaining responsible gambling behavior. Individuals should remain watchful if they often chase losses, gamble longer than originally planned, or feel uneasy about their wagering activities. An additional warning sign involves neglecting personal obligations or relationships as a result of gambling. Heightened secrecy surrounding gambling behaviors, including concealing activities or being dishonest about time spent, may also signal an escalating problem. Players could encounter financial difficulties, redirecting money designated for essential expenses into gambling. Recognizing these signs early can help individuals implement limits or seek help, ensuring that gambling remains a form of entertainment rather than a source of stress or harm.

Secure Payment Options for Online Transactions

Steering through the realm of online gambling necessitates a keen knowledge of secure payment methods. Gamblers should focus on options that offer both security and convenience. Credit and debit cards are still a common choice, providing instant transaction processing, but they come with certain vulnerabilities if the site is not secure. Online payment platforms like copyright, Skrill, and Neteller are growing in popularity due to their enhanced security features, allowing users to complete payments without directly sharing financial details. Digital currencies, especially Bitcoin, are rising in prominence for its anonymity and distributed framework, attracting those who value discretion in their gambling activities. Additionally, prepaid cards offer a straightforward approach, enabling players to load funds without linking to their financial accounts. At the end of the day, players should opt for payment methods that align with their security preferences while ensuring the gaming site utilizes robust security measures to secure financial information.

Enable Two-Step Authentication

Enabling two-step verification significantly strengthens safety for online gambling. This supplementary safeguard demands that users supply dual verification credentials before accessing their accounts, generally consisting of something they know such as a password as well as something they have for example a smartphone. Through the use of two-factor authentication, players greatly reduce the likelihood of account breaches, because malicious actors would need both credentials to breach an account. Numerous trusted online casinos support dual verification methods, prompting players to enable this option when creating an account or in their security preferences. Embracing this security measure not only safeguards personal information but also strengthens confidence within the online gaming space, ensuring a more secure and enjoyable experience.
